Section 15A(I) of the Act specifies the certain acts and records which should be prepared and authorized by a conveyancer. A conveyancer approves duty for the accuracy of particular facts in these acts or documents. Conveyancers have to know the 390 items of legislation governing land registration consisting of the common regulation and conference resolutions which date back regarding 1938.


In a regular enrollment and transfer process, the attorney is included with greater than 50 tasks, entailing up to 12 events, prior to the deal can be finished. The conveyancer has to manage all the events included and he thinks duty for the collection and payment of all amounts due. After a contract of sale has been entered, a conveyancer is assigned, and instructions are sent out to him by the estate agent or by the seller.


In a 'normal' sale such as a transfer that results from a sale that was produced by the efforts of an estate agent, there are 3 conveyancing lawyers associated with the property purchasing and selling procedure: They move the residential or commercial property from the vendor to the purchaser. Affidavits and more papers the buyer and vendor must authorize an affidavit in which they verify their identity, marriage standing, solvency along with a FICA sworn statement. Transfer responsibility and worth added tax (BARREL) affirmation the buyer and seller should authorize this to validate the purchase rate, which is communicated to the South African Receiver of Income (SARS) for the calculation of transfer task (generally paid by the vendor).


SARS will issue a receipt for the transfer responsibility. The seller needs to consent to the termination of his mortgage bond (if applicable) and the new action is lodged at the Deeds Workplace, where it is signed up within 8 to 2 week. The vendor's mortgage bond is cancelled, and the balance paid to the vendor, less the estate representatives payment.

Conveyancing is the legal transfer of building from someone to another. Although conveyancing has various other applications, it is most frequently used to property purchases. The conveyancing process encompasses all the lawful and administrative job that ensures a property transfer stands under the legislation. Conveyancing is what makes a building transfer legitimate.
